KVM: Add "exiting guest mode" state

Currently we keep track of only two states: guest mode and host
mode.  This patch adds an "exiting guest mode" state that tells
us that an IPI will happen soon, so unless we need to wait for the
IPI, we can avoid it completely.

Also
1: No need atomically to read/write ->mode in vcpu's thread

2: reorganize struct kvm_vcpu to make ->mode and ->requests
   in the same cache line explicitly
